Lotus Plumule for Better Sleep: Can This Traditional Herbal Remedy Really Help Insomnia?

For centuries, lotus plumule—the small green embryo found inside lotus seeds—has been used in traditional Asian medicine as a natural remedy to promote relaxation and improve sleep. Often brewed into a mild herbal tea, lotus plumule is believed to calm the mind and reduce restlessness.
But does modern science support these traditional claims? Here's what we know.
What Is Lotus Plumule?

Lotus plumule is the tiny green sprout located inside the seed of the sacred lotus (Nelumbo nucifera).
It contains a variety of naturally occurring plant compounds, including:
-
Alkaloids
-
Flavonoids
-
Polyphenols
-
Antioxidants
These bioactive compounds have attracted scientific interest for their potential health benefits.
1. May Promote Relaxation

Traditional medicine has long used lotus plumule to help calm the nervous system.
Preliminary laboratory and animal studies suggest that certain alkaloids found in lotus plumule may have mild calming effects, although more human clinical research is needed.
2. May Support Better Sleep Quality
Many people drink lotus plumule tea before bedtime to help them relax.
Although scientific evidence in humans is still limited, its calming properties may help some individuals unwind as part of a healthy bedtime routine.
It should not be considered a treatment for chronic insomnia.
3. Rich in Antioxidants

Lotus plumule contains natural antioxidants that help protect cells from oxidative stress.
These compounds may contribute to:
-
Healthy aging.
-
Reduced cellular damage.
-
Overall wellness.
4. May Help Support Heart Health
Some early research suggests that compounds in lotus plumule may help support healthy blood vessel function and circulation.
However, larger human studies are needed before firm conclusions can be drawn.
5. May Help Manage Stress

Stress is one of the most common causes of poor sleep.
Enjoying a warm cup of lotus plumule tea in the evening may help create a relaxing bedtime ritual, which can support healthy sleep habits.
6. May Support Healthy Blood Pressure
Some laboratory studies suggest that certain plant compounds in lotus plumule may help relax blood vessels.
People taking medication for high blood pressure should consult their healthcare provider before regularly consuming herbal products with potential blood pressure effects.
7. Naturally Caffeine-Free

Unlike coffee or black tea, lotus plumule tea contains no caffeine.
This makes it a suitable evening beverage for many people who want to avoid stimulants before bedtime.
8. Easy to Prepare at Home
Making lotus plumule tea is simple.
Instructions:
-
Add a small pinch of dried lotus plumule to a cup.
-
Pour in hot (not boiling) water.
-
Steep for 5–10 minutes.
-
Strain and enjoy.
Because lotus plumule has a naturally bitter taste, some people add a small amount of honey after the tea has cooled slightly.
Tips for Better Sleep
If you're struggling with occasional sleeplessness, combine herbal tea with healthy sleep habits:
-
Go to bed and wake up at the same time every day.
-
Avoid caffeine late in the afternoon and evening.
-
Limit screen time for at least one hour before bed.
-
Keep your bedroom cool, dark, and quiet.
-
Exercise regularly, but avoid intense workouts close to bedtime.
Good sleep hygiene often has a greater impact than any single herbal remedy.
Are There Any Precautions?
Although lotus plumule is generally consumed as a traditional herbal tea, keep these points in mind:
-
Scientific evidence for treating insomnia remains limited.
-
People who are pregnant, breastfeeding, or taking medications should consult a healthcare professional before using herbal remedies regularly.
-
Stop using it if you experience an allergic reaction or digestive discomfort.
-
Persistent insomnia should be evaluated by a healthcare provider, especially if it lasts for several weeks or affects daily life.
The Bottom Line
Lotus plumule has been used for generations as a traditional herbal remedy to promote relaxation and restful sleep. While early research suggests it contains beneficial plant compounds with antioxidant and calming properties, more high-quality human studies are needed to confirm its effectiveness for insomnia.
For occasional difficulty sleeping, enjoying a warm cup of lotus plumule tea alongside healthy sleep habits may be a soothing addition to your evening routine. However, it should complement—not replace—medical evaluation and treatment for chronic sleep problems.
